MR. EDITOR- I wish to inquire for my son, a young man about 26 years of age. His name is Turner Saterfield. He left home Feb. 10, 1874, and I have have heard from him once; he was then in Cincinnati, O. He was to lave Cincinnati in a few days for Memphis, Tenn., at the time I heard from him. I think it was in 1877. My name is Permelia Saterfield.…
MR. EDITOR: William Frago left this place in time of war. His mother belonged to Sewell Carr, and was then Aley Carr, but is now Aley Pruett. The boy left with Gen. Paine. His mother and sister, still living, would like to know where he is. WM. BRYANT, Gallatin, Tenn.
